Data Entry In information

What is a data entry in?

Data Entry In jobs involve inputting, updating, and maintaining information in computer systems or databases. Employees in these roles are responsible for ensuring data accuracy, organizing records, and sometimes verifying information from various sources. These positions are essential in many industries, as accurate data is crucial for operations, reporting, and decision-making. Data Entry In professionals need good attention to detail, typing skills, and basic computer proficiency.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a data entry in?

To thrive as a Data Entry In, you need strong attention to detail, fast and accurate typing skills,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with spreadsheet software like Microsoft Excel, data management systems, and sometimes basic knowledge of database tools is typically required. Excellent organizational skills, time management, and the ability to maintain confidentiality help individuals stand out in this role. These skills ensure data accuracy, efficiency, and trustworthy handling of sensitive information, which are critical for business operations.

What are some common challenges faced in a data entry in, and how can they be effectively managed?

Data Entry professionals often encounter challenges such as handling large volumes of repetitive information, maintaining high accuracy, and meeting tight deadlines. To manage these effectively, it's important to develop strong attention to detail, establish efficient workflows, and take regular breaks to reduce fatigue and maintain focus. Utilizing keyboard shortcuts and data management tools can also help streamline the process and minimize errors, ensuring that data is entered quickly and accurately.

Are any data entry jobs legit?

Data entry jobs are legitimate roles that involve inputting information into digital systems, often requiring basic computer skills and attention to detail. However, job seekers should be cautious of scams and verify employers before providing personal information or payment, as some listings may be fraudulent.

Is data entry hard to learn?

Data entry is generally straightforward to learn, especially with basic computer skills and familiarity with spreadsheet or database software. It involves tasks like inputting, updating, and managing information, which can be mastered through practice and training. Many roles require attention to detail and accuracy but do not demand advanced technical knowledge.

General Description

As an Operations Supervisor, you will play a critical leadership role within our Transfer Station business units, overseeing daily operations and ensuring the safe and efficient performance of Transfer Station Employees. Your responsibilities will include employee observations, leading monthly safety meetings, and maintaining compliance with company policies and industry regulations.

You will be responsible for ensuring that safety, compliance, customer service, growth, sales, and financial targets are consistently met. Strong leadership, ethical decision-making, and professionalism are essential to success in this role. This is a 12-month contract with he possibility of permanent employment.

As an Operations Supervisor with us, the minimum responsibilities are:

  • Supervise and manage the daily operations of our City of Hamilton Transfer Stations.

  • Review daily schedules to assess financial and operational performance of AZ Drivers, Transfer Station Attendants, and Equipment Operators.

  • Conduct operational audits to ensure efficiency and compliance.

  • Ensure all staff complete daily safety and maintenance inspections for all company sites, vehicles, and equipment.

  • Plan and monitor employee schedules, maintaining communication throughout the day until all tasks are completed.

  • Lead the recruitment process, including interviewing, selecting, and training new employees.

  • Implement performance management processes, including progressive discipline as necessary.

  • Conduct thorough incident investigations when necessary, including scene management, first incident reporting, root cause analysis, and implementation of preventive measures.

  • Maintain and enforce Environmental Health and Safety (EH&S) programs, including training, safety meetings, and compliance reporting.

  • Ensure full compliance with company safety policies, MTO regulations, and other applicable industry guidelines.

Schedule: Day Shift Monday to Friday, with rotating Saturdays on-site (every 3rd Saturday) as well as Tuesday to Saturday when a holiday occurs in the week.
